首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

c连接mysql数据库服务器失败

连接MySQL数据库服务器失败是指在尝试建立与MySQL数据库服务器的连接时出现问题。这可能是由于多种原因引起的,下面我将详细解释可能的原因和解决方法。

  1. 网络问题:首先,确保您的网络连接正常,并且可以访问MySQL服务器所在的IP地址和端口。您可以尝试使用ping命令来测试与服务器的网络连通性。如果网络连接存在问题,您可以联系网络管理员或云服务提供商进行故障排除。
  2. 防火墙设置:防火墙可能会阻止您的应用程序与MySQL服务器建立连接。您需要确保防火墙允许从您的应用程序所在的服务器访问MySQL服务器的IP地址和端口。具体的设置方法因操作系统和防火墙软件而异,请参考相关文档或联系系统管理员。
  3. MySQL服务器配置:检查MySQL服务器的配置文件,确保MySQL服务器已正确配置为允许远程连接。您需要确认bind-address参数是否设置为MySQL服务器的IP地址,并且skip-networking参数未启用。如果需要修改配置文件,修改后需要重启MySQL服务器才能生效。
  4. 用户权限:确保您使用的MySQL用户具有足够的权限来连接到MySQL服务器。您可以尝试使用root用户进行连接,如果连接成功,则说明是权限问题。在生产环境中,为了安全起见,建议创建一个仅具有必要权限的用户,并使用该用户进行连接。
  5. 数据库服务状态:检查MySQL服务器的运行状态。您可以尝试重启MySQL服务器,并检查日志文件以获取更多信息。如果MySQL服务器未正常运行,您需要修复服务器故障或联系技术支持。

腾讯云提供了一系列与MySQL相关的产品和服务,以下是一些推荐的产品和产品介绍链接:

  • 云数据库MySQL:腾讯云提供的一种高性能、可扩展的云数据库服务,支持自动备份、容灾、监控等功能。了解更多:云数据库MySQL
  • 云数据库TDSQL:腾讯云提供的一种基于TDSQL引擎的云数据库服务,具有更高的性能和可靠性。了解更多:云数据库TDSQL
  • 数据库审计:腾讯云提供的一种数据库审计服务,可以记录和分析数据库操作,帮助您满足合规性要求。了解更多:数据库审计

请注意,以上仅是腾讯云提供的一些相关产品和服务,您可以根据实际需求选择适合的产品。同时,还有其他云服务提供商也提供类似的产品和服务,您可以根据自己的需求进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券